Computer Classes for Over 50’s at Woori Community House



Woori Community House in Woori Yallock is hosting free computer classes from 9.30am to 12pm every Friday. for people aged over 50 to help alleviate their frustrations with anything digital.

Located at Shop 5/ 18935 Healesville-Koo Wee Rup Rd, Woori Yallock, tech volunteers will be able to help people with their own devices or at in-house computers. The programs is part of the Federal Government’s Be Connected initiative, aimed at increasing the confidence, skills and online safety of older Australians in digital literacy.

Places are limited, so pre-booking is essential for entry and assistance. Attendees can express their interest by calling 5964 6857, emailing info@wooricommhouse.org.au or online www.wooricommhouse.org.au/ourcourses
